Video Transcript

"Welcome back to the after effects basics training on Expert Village. Now we are going to be talking about importing footage in after effects. There are lots of different ways to do this. I'm going to talk you through a couple of them. One way is to select a project window and then right click or control on a Mac, select import file and then just select a file from the finder or browser that you wish to import into your after effects project. If you wanted to import just one file that is doable. You can also select multiple files and import all those at once and they all will show up separately here in the project window. You can also select a folder and then tell after effects to import that folder. When we do that after effects will actually create that folder with all of the files contained in the project window. The thing about after effects is that it references your files. So these brushed images that I've imported are not actually recreated they're only being reference from their original location. So, we will talk about this later but it's going to be really important to keep all your project assets organized in a very neat and orderly fashion so that after effects can find them easily. There also another way to import footage by selecting import file from the file pull down menu at the top of your screen. Just use any one of these methods whichever one most comfortable for you."
